Field Sales Executive — Bespoke Architectural Products | £75,000–£100,000+ OTE

Currently working in B2C direct sales, home improvement consulting, or high-end architectural sales and looking for pre-confirmed client appointments? Here is why our sales executives close more high-ticket orders and build higher-earning schedules.

The Reality of This Role

This is a self-employed, commission-only field role offering complete schedule independence and uncapped earning potential, backed by a premier UK manufacturer operating a 32,000 sq. ft facility. To ensure you never start from scratch, the company invests in a £1m annual marketing budget to deliver 2 to 3 pre-confirmed appointments daily directly to your diary — zero cold calling or self-lead generation required.

Mandatory Requirements:

  • Hold a full UK driving licence
  • Own a reliable vehicle
  • Have a smartphone for daily field operations
  • Willing to travel up to a 75-mile radius across a standard 5-day working week
  • Proven track record in B2C direct sales, home improvement, or high-end architectural product closing

Earnings & Key Proof Points

  • Average Team Earnings: Realistic £75,000 baseline annual income across the sales team, with top performers achieving £150,000+.
  • Weekly Earnings: Weekly commissions frequently reach £2,000+ as you master the portfolio.
  • High Close Rate: Consistent 30% average conversion rate maintained across the product range.
  • Daily Pipeline: 2–3 pre-confirmed in-home appointments supplied to your diary daily via £1m annual national marketing.

What We Provide

  • Complete professional physical sample kit and company tablet supplied at zero cost
  • 2-day residential training course covering intensive product specs, compliance, and sales pitching
  • Ongoing 1-on-1 mentorship and direct technical back-office support

What You Will Do

  • Conduct 2–3 in-home consultations daily (60–90 min visits) advising on verandas, awnings, and insulated garage doors
  • Demonstrate bespoke UK-made architectural solutions using provided physical samples and digital tablet tools
  • Guide homeowners through technical specifications and design options to secure signed same-day contracts
  • Provide regular activity updates while collaborating with central Marketing, Design, and Technical teams

What We Look For

  • Confident face-to-face closing ability with strong empathy and professional property presentation skills
  • Target-driven mindset comfortable managing a 75-mile regional territory using digital tablet tools
